This live-action Disney film with special effects about a green piece of flub was first released in theaters on November 26, 1997; followed by its VHS release on April 21, 1998.

Synopsis[]

Brilliant but befuddled Professor Philip Brainard (played by Robin Williams) is on the brink of inventing a revolutionary energy source and missing his wedding to fiancée Dr. Sara Jean Reynolds – president of financially challenged Midfield College – for the third time! When Philip experiments with his own big bang theory, a miraculous elastic goo called Flubber emerges, leaving him ecstatic but unmarried! Philip and his flying cyber sidekick Weebo soon discover that Flubber, applied to anything, enables it to bounce super high and fast. However, many questions remain. Is Flubber goo enough to win Sara back, save Midfield from its financial problems and slip through the hands of the evil financier who is bankrolling the college?
